Home destroyed Synonyms
Synonyms for phrase
HD abbreviation
HD is an abbreviation for Home DestroyedWhat does HD stand for?
HD stands for "Home Destroyed" Definitions for Destroyed
- (adjective) spoiled or ruined or demolished
- (adjective) destroyed physically or morally